Download Algorithm Synthesis: A Comparative Study by D. M. Steier, A. P. Anderson (auth.) PDF

By D. M. Steier, A. P. Anderson (auth.)

In early 1986, considered one of us (D.M.S.) used to be developing a man-made intelligence procedure to layout algorithms, and the opposite (A.P.A.) was once getting began in software adjustments examine. We shared an place of work, and exchanged a couple of papers at the systematic improvement of algorithms from necessities. progressively we discovered that we have been attempting to clear up many of the similar difficulties. And so, regardless of radical transformations among ourselves in study methods, we set out jointly to determine what lets research from those papers. that is how this ebook began: a number of graduate scholars attempting to deal with The Literature. before everything, there has been only a checklist of papers. one in all us (D.M.S.) attempted to solid the papers in a uniform framework via describing the matter areas searched, an method utilized in synthetic intelligence for knowing many projects. The generalized challenge house descriptions, notwithstanding precious, appeared to summary an excessive amount of, so we made up our minds to match papers via diverse authors facing a similar set of rules. those comparisons proved an important: for then we started to see related key layout offerings for every algorithm.

Show description

Read or Download Algorithm Synthesis: A Comparative Study PDF

Best comparative books

Is Japan Really Changing Its Ways?: Regulatory Reform and the Japanese Economy

Deregulation has been on the best of Japan's monetary coverage time table for a few years. Now, in the course of a monetary drawback that engulfs all of Asia, pressures at the eastern executive for significant reform - coming from either in and out forces - are enhanced than ever. yet is Japan really making the alterations essential to lessen marketplace controls, inspire pageant, and create new possibilities for imports?

Supranational Citizenship

Do we conceptualise a type of citizenship that don't need to be of a countryside, yet may be of quite a few political frameworks? Bringing jointly political thought with debates approximately ecu integration, diplomacy and the altering nature of citizenship, this e-book bargains a coherent and leading edge idea of a citizenship self reliant of any particular kind of political association and relates that belief of citizenship to topical problems with the ecu Union: democracy and legit authority; non-national political neighborhood; and the character of the supranational structure.

Evolutionary Computation Techniques: A Comparative Perspective

This booklet compares the functionality of assorted evolutionary computation (EC) ideas once they are confronted with complicated optimization difficulties extracted from assorted engineering domain names. quite concentrating on lately built algorithms, it really is designed in order that each one bankruptcy may be learn independently.

Additional resources for Algorithm Synthesis: A Comparative Study

Sample text

Divide-and-conquer algorithm for auxiliary function. 3. Composite 45 Most of the designs of divide-and-conquer algorithms we have seen follow the strategy of designing composition operators given known decomposition operators, or of designing decomposition operators given known composition operators. Both of these strategies assume that both subproblems produced by the decomposition will be solved recursively, but Smith's formalism only requires a recursive solution to the one of the subproblems, leaving the decision about what to do with the other subproblem open.

Both of these strategies assume that both subproblems produced by the decomposition will be solved recursively, but Smith's formalism only requires a recursive solution to the one of the subproblems, leaving the decision about what to do with the other subproblem open. In most of his derivations, the other subproblem is either also recursively solved or else just passed along to the composition operator. Another possibility, explored in this derivation, is the design of a relatively complex auxiliary operator to apply to the second subproblem.

One interesting feature of this derivation, which appears in some of the other presentations we studied, is the initial decision to have the partition element selected nondeterministically, to avoid making premature commitment to a particular implementation. Though not shown in the chart (apparently embedded in the recursion removal), a later step replaces the nondeterministic selection with a deterministic choice of the last element in the sequence, presumably made for reasons of convenience in the target language.

Download PDF sample

Rated 4.79 of 5 – based on 41 votes